PerkinElmer is seeking an innovative and dynamic scientist with strong communication skills.  Opportunities exist to a) develop    biochemical and cell-based applications for a range of PerkinElmer immunoassay technologies such as AlphaLISA®, HTRF® and DELFIA®, b) develop total solutions utilizing EnVision® and VICTOR Nivo™ Multimode Plate Readers and JANUS® automated liquid handling workstation, and c) participate in customer-facing technical events and support Field Application Scientists.

Responsibilities:

  • Develop strategic applications using immunoassay technologies such as AlphaLISA, HTRF and DELFIA to support the Life Sciences business and commercial teams.
  • Based on experimental data, author technical collateral such as application notes, guides and technical briefs.
  • Author applications-based peer-reviewed publications, scientific posters and presentations for webinars.
  • Evaluate novel assay technologies for the Life Sciences portfolio.
  • Support reagents and instruments demonstrations and trainings for customers in a technical capacity.
  • Work collaboratively with team members and other PerkinElmer organizations in developing applications.

Basic Qualifications:

  • Bachelors in Science degree and 2+ years experience.

or

  • Advanced Degree in Biochemistry or related field and 0 years of experience.
